Understanding Private Mental Health Diagnosis
Private mental health diagnosis describes the process of examining mental health conditions by qualified specialists in a private practice setting. This can consist of psychologists, psychiatrists, clinical social workers, and certified counselors. Such services often assure a greater level of privacy and customized care than may be discovered in public health care systems.
Why Consider a Private Diagnosis?
There are numerous reasons individuals may choose to pursue a private mental health diagnosis:

Reduced Wait Times: Public health care systems often have long waiting lists, especially for specialist assessments. Private services provide quicker access to needed examinations.

Personalized Attention: In a private setting, people might experience more individually time with their professionals, permitting a more customized technique to their mental health concerns.

Privacy and Comfort: Those who look for a private diagnosis might feel more comfortable going over delicate concerns with somebody in a private practice, lowering possible stigma associated with mental healthcare.

Extensive Assessments: Many private professionals provide holistic assessments that consist of a full evaluation of mental, physical, and social aspects contributing to the patient's condition.
How to Find Private Mental Health Diagnosis Services Near You
Discovering private mental health services can feel challenging, but different resources can help improve the process. Here's a step-by-step guide to locating these service providers:
Step-by-Step Guide
Online Research: Start by conducting online searches utilizing terms like "private mental health diagnostic services near me" or "psychologists in [your location]" Sites such as Psychology Today permit you to filter based on specializeds and locations.

Seek Advice From with Medical Professionals: Speak with your primary care doctor or any other relied on physician. They can often supply recommendations to reliable mental health experts.

Examine Credentials: Once you have a list of possible service providers, check their qualifications through local licensing boards to guarantee they are licensed and have tidy disciplinary records.

Read Reviews: Online evaluations on platforms like Yelp or Google can offer insight into the experiences of previous customers. Nevertheless, remember that experiences can vary commonly.

Insurance coverage Coverage: If you have medical insurance, refer to your plan to see if it covers any private mental health services. Some specialists might offer sliding scale costs for those without insurance.

Schedule Consultations: Many specialists offer initial assessments. Utilize this opportunity to examine whether their approach resonates with you.

Q1: How much does a private mental health diagnosis cost?

The cost of private mental health diagnostics differs widely based on the company, place, and specific services provided. Usually, preliminary evaluations can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500, while ongoing sessions might vary from ₤ 75 to ₤ 250.

Q2: How long does it take to get a diagnosis?

The time required for a diagnosis can vary based on the intricacy of the case and the supplier's method. Some assessments might take one session, while others might require several consultations over several weeks.

Q3: Do I require a recommendation for a private mental health diagnosis?

Most of the times, you do not require a referral to seek care from a private mental health supplier. However, talk to your health insurance plan if you plan to utilize insurance coverage to cover expenses.

Q4: What should I anticipate during my very first appointment?

Your very first visit generally includes an intake assessment, where the supplier will ask concerns about your mental and physical health history, current signs, and any previous treatments.
